Title: Research on sustainable development with regard to the economic system and the energy system in Mainland China

Abstract: In the system of sustainable development, the energy is the base, the economy is the core, and it is the key to ensuring the harmonious development between the energy system and the economic system. In this paper, using the principal component analysis method, the complex development index and the harmonious development index of the energy system and the economic system are formulated based on the actual datum in 1980–2000 of Mainland China. This is followed by an analysis of the relation between economic development and energy supply during the past 20 years in Mainland China. And then, an analysis of the economic development and the energy supply in Mainland China in the future is given. Finally, some advices on sustainable development with regard to the energy system and the economic system have been brought forward based on the research results.
